## 1. Affiliation
**1.1** All Clubs wishing to participate in Cape Town Table Tennis during the upcoming season must pay an annual affiliation fee of **One Thousand Five Hundred Rand (R1 500)** at, or should they elect to, before the Annual General Meeting (AGM). The AGM is usually held on the Last Saturday in November of each calendar year.
**1.2** The Annual Affiliation fee for Clubs, Teams and Players for successive years shall be proposed by the CTTT Executive at the AGM of the organisation and approved by a simple majority vote.
**1.3** Should a Club fail to pay the Annual Affiliation fee in accordance with the requirements of clause 1.1, a late payment penalty of **Five Hundred Rand (R500)** will be added for late payment.
**1.4** Late payments, inclusive of applicable penalties, must be made by the deadline date as determined by the General Council at the AGM, which date shall not be later than 1st M&R Meeting of the new calendar year plus R500 as per Clause 1.3.
**1.5** Failure to pay the affiliation fee and any applicable penalties by the final deadline date may result in **suspension from all league and tournament activities** for the Season.
**1.6** All clubs operating under the auspices of CTTT must comply with these affiliation fee provisions, which are peremptory and not negotiable.
### Affiliation / Registration Procedures
Clubs must submit the following to the CTTT Secretary and Treasurer at the AGM:
- Completed Registration/Affiliation form as provided
- Proof of payment if paid via EFT
- A copy of the Club's Constitution AND Code of Conduct
Registration of New Clubs are subject to approval by the Executive Committee and must demonstrate compliance with the Organisation's Constitution and Bye-laws before affiliation is approved and granted.
### Compliance
- All Affiliated clubs must comply with regulations, policies, and directives of the ITTF, SATTB and Cape Town Table Tennis (CTTT), including any amendments or updates issued from time to time.
- Material Non-compliance by affiliated clubs, including repeated or serious breaches of the abovementioned regulations, may result in sanctions.
- The Executive Committee is authorised to issue written warnings.
> **NB.** Any Suspension or Expulsion of an affiliated club or member from CTTT may only be decided upon and effected by the General Body in accordance with any requirements as set out in the Constitution.

## 2. Registration
**2.1** Clubs must submit the following to the CTTT Secretary and Treasurer at the AGM:
- Completed Registration/Affiliation form as provided
- Proof of payment if paid via EFT
- A copy of the Club's Constitution AND Code of Conduct
Registration of New Clubs are subject to approval by the Executive Committee and must demonstrate compliance with the Organisation's Constitution and Bye-laws before affiliation is approved and granted.
**2.2** All Clubs, and their Players wishing to participate in League Teams must be in good standing with the organisation, and registered with the CTTT Treasurer, and M&R Secretary, via their Club's League Representative, prior to their participation in the League programme.
**2.3** All teams shall be registered on the official League Team Entry Form with the names of the players that will compete in those teams. No teams shall be accepted if the players' names are not declared.
**2.4** Clubs are required to pay the Club, Team and Player Registration **IN FULL** at the Registration Meeting. Clubs rendering payment directly into CTTT account or via EFT MUST submit a proof of payment together with the registration forms.
**2.5** A club is permitted to change the status of a member from player to social member only if the said member has not participated in any league fixtures. If a registration fee had been paid for said member then a club may apply for a refund; or the registration fee may be allocated to a new member.
**2.6** Notwithstanding the above, subsequent additional Player Registrations will be accepted after the initial Teams have been submitted provided that the Player is in good standing with the Organisation. The player registration form in addition to an updated league team form must be submitted to the M&R Secretary prior to league participation.
**2.7** Also that the current League fee is received from the Club by CTTT within 7 days of the player's participation with proof of payment to the M&R Secretary. Failing which, all matches played by the Player will be forfeited. (see Clause 2.17)
**2.8** No person shall play in league matches unless he/she has been registered as a league player by their club.
**2.9** A player registered as a Social player may only play in tournaments.
**2.10** No transfer will be considered by the Executive Committee unless the player concerned is in good standing with his/her club. Also has informed their club of their intention to transfer, and obtained, and completed the Transfer Form, signed and approved by their existing club official, and the official of the club that they intend joining. Then submitted to the CTTT Executive for accreditation prior to participation in the league programme.
**2.11** No player shall play in any league match unless he/she has **resided seven (7) days** in the Cape Town region.
**2.12** No player registered outside Cape Town shall be permitted to play in CTTT leagues prior to forwarding a clearance to the CTTT Executive from the previous organisation [see also 2.4 above]. Also where applicable, the official body of the last Country of participation.
**2.13** Any club playing an ineligible player shall forfeit to the opposing team all points in respect of matches in which such player participated, and **a fine of R200** will be imposed on the club of the defaulting team.
**2.14** Registration fees per annum shall be:
**Club Affiliation — Category of Fees:**
| Category | Description |
|---|---|
| Senior League | Team Registration, Senior Player, Junior Playing in the Senior League, Player with Disability, Veteran 60 to 70, Veteran 70+ |
| Junior League | Team Registration, Junior Player |
> Veterans 70+ shall not be liable for fees.
**2.15** Players registered as "social players" by their club are not liable for registration fees unless subsequently used in the Junior or Senior Leagues; then the difference in player registration will be payable.
**2.16** Players registered in the second round of the season are liable for **half of the player registration fees**.
**2.17** Club, team and player registration fees are to be set at the Annual General Meeting. Subject to proof, players who turn 60 during a season would be deemed to be 60 at the start of the season.
